Introduction
Interpretation of the standard for the test method of rhodium-carbon catalyst activity
This standard (GB/T 37360-2019) specifies the test method for the activity of rhodium-carbon catalysts, which is applicable to the activity test of rhodium-carbon catalysts in the hydrogenation reduction reactions of aromatic rings, heterocyclic rings, nitro groups, nitriles, aliphatic carboxylic acids and other fine chemicals.

Test Equipment and Performance Requirements
| Serial Number | Item | Performance Parameters |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Reactor Specification (316L Stainless Steel)/mL | 500 |
| 2 | Maximum Operating Pressure/MPa | 10 |
| 3 | Maximum Operating Temperature/C | 300 |
| 4 | Maximum Operating Speed/(r/min) | 1500 |
| 5 | Parallelism (extreme difference)/% | ≤3 |
Experimental steps and data analysis
During the experiment, the following steps need to be followed:
- o-chloronitrobenzene reacts with hydrogen under the action of rhodium carbon catalyst to produce o-chloroaniline and water.
- The mass fraction of o-chloronitrobenzene before and after the reaction is determined by gas chromatograph, and its conversion rate is calculated to characterize the catalyst activity.
- The activity is calculated according to the formula: $$ E = \frac{w_1 - w_2}{w_1} \times 100\% $$, where $E$ is the conversion rate, $w_1$ and $w_2$ are the mass fractions of o-chloronitrobenzene in the raw material and product, respectively.
The experimental results show that this method has good parallelism and reproducibility (≤3%), ensuring the reliability of the data.
